Hot Water Heating
In today’s plumbing market, there are many hot water heating systems to choose from. We can offer every type of hot water heater on the market. Hot water systems can be supplemented by one of our Solar Thermal systems. Commercial hot water heating can become 400% efficient when installing a Geothermal system. Below are our traditional hot water heating systems to choose from.
Tank Types
Tank type water heaters maintain a tank full of hot water at all times. On demand type water heaters are more efficient; however, they cannot offer recirculation lines to cut down on wait time for hot water at the plumbing fixture. A recirculation line will create a constant flow of hot water from the farthest fixture to the hot water tank, eliminating wait time for hot water at a sink, tub, shower, etc.
Electric

This hot water heater offers trouble free use for our customers that do not have propane available in their buildings. These heaters range in every size for every need.

Propane Power Vented

Reliable hot water heating for medium to large homes that have propane but do not have a masonry chimney available for flue piping. The flue piping for this type of water heater is installed with PVC through the band joist of the building.

Indirect

Efficient hot water heating for homes that have a hot water boiler that will heat a tank of potable hot water.

Propane Direct Venting

Reliable hot water heating for medium to large homes that have propane and a masonry chimney available for flue piping.

Tankless
Gas Fired Electric
Gas fired tank-less hot water heater are the most efficient conventional way to heat your potable hot water. Fired only when a hot water fixture is used, gas fired tank-less hot water heater modulate their gas train based on the amount of hot water that is needed.

Electric tank-less hot water heaters are good for a building that uses very little hot water at a local point such as an office building with a hand washing sink. While not nearly as efficient as their gas fired counterparts, they are much less expensive to install and good for small loads.
